After going 2-3 without Caitlin Clark, the Indiana Fever will finally be returning their All- WNBA guard. On Saturday, Clark, who had been recovering from a quad strain, and the Fever took on Sabrina Ionescu and the New York Liberty, a team that has been missing some key pieces as well.

The New York Liberty 's star-studded squad was missing something as the 2024 regular season ended. Though a team with Sabrina Ionescu, Jonquel Jones and Breanna Stewart finished with a WNBA -best 32-8 record, head coach Sandy Brondello decided that rookie forward Leonie Fiebich needed to be in the starting lineup when the playoffs began.
